TeV gamma-ray observations of Southern BL Lacs with the CANGAROO 3.8m Imaging Telescope

Observational and theoretical results indicate that low-redshift BL Lacertae objects are the most likely extragalactic sources to be detectable at TeV energies. In this paper we present the results of observations of 4 BL Lacertae objects (PKS0521 365, EXO0423.4 0840, PKS2005 489 and PKS2316 423) made between 1993 and 1996 with the CANGAROO 3.8m imaging Cerenkov telescope. During the period of these observations the gamma-ray energy threshold of the 3.8m telescope was 2TeV. Searches for steady long-term emission have been made, and, inspired by the TeV ares detected from Mkn 421 and Mkn 501, a search on a night-by-night timescale has also been performed for each source. Comprehensive Monte Carlo simulations are used to estimate upper limits for both steady and short timescale emission.
